What happened

Players began copying the game’s colored-square result into group chats and timelines. It revealed the shape of a solve without revealing the answer, turning a private puzzle into daily small talk.

Where it came from

Josh Wardle released Wordle publicly in late 2021: a once-a-day five-letter word puzzle with six attempts and one shared answer.

Why it mattered

Wordle made sharing deliberately modest again. It was not a leaderboard or a stream; it was one quiet, repeatable invitation to compare a tiny piece of your day.

How it spread

The ritual exploded from a few dozen players to millions before The New York Times acquired the game in January 2022. The share grid became recognizable even to people who had never opened the site.
